Egon Friedell (born Egon Friedmann; 21 January 1878, in Vienna – 16 March 1938, in Vienna) was an Austrian cultural historian, playwright, actor and Kabarett performer, journalist and theatre critic. Before 1916, he was also known by his pen name Egon Friedländer.
